It’s a frosty Friday afternoon here in Edmonton but the good news is that we've got a brand new episode of Oilersnation Radio to warm up your inside feelings as you head into the weekend. This week, we looked at the Oilers' heater, Mike Smith's hot start, and spoke to former NHLer Shayne Corson about what's going on around the National Hockey League. To kick off this week's podcast, we got start with the Sherwood Ford Giant Question which looked at which Oiler we would name as the team's MVP for the month of February if we took Connor and Leon out of the equation. Is it Jesse Puljujarvi who stepped up on the first line since getting the call? Is it Mike Smith who has looked incredible since coming back from injury? Someone else? Changing gears, we looked at Zack Kassian and where he will fit in the lineup when he's finally healthy again. Seeing as none of us had a really good answer for the question, Dave Tippett will have some very interesting decisions to make when it comes to his line combos going forward. From there, we were thrilled to welcome former Oiler, Shayne Corson, to the podcast to talk about the North Division and what it must be like to play the same teams over and over again. Corson also gave his thoughts on fighting in hockey and whether or not the game has changed for the worse now that the self-policing has stopped.
